Output 63a97f5c034f2086ea019a70793a2c50db3d462783a728f35d6c41145eb23302:2

value
22979826
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3a68a9e81323801d450165654b3433d569da41b OP_EQUALVERIFY OP_CHECKSIG
address
1Mkhu3vnyf4W9FkADFN3Zk9ffT6poYBxMa
transaction
63a97f5c034f2086ea019a70793a2c50db3d462783a728f35d6c41145eb23302
spent
true